Local soils and drainage play a big role in material performance; clayey or poorly draining soils need a stable, well-draining base. Pick materials from the gravel, sand, dirt, stone group that promote drainage or pair them with a sub-base or geotextile where needed. If you have chronic standing water, plan for grading or drainage features in addition to material choice.
Heat and humidity can accelerate breakdown of softer materials and make fine soils rut when wet. Generally, denser, angular aggregates from the gravel, sand, dirt, stone group that compact well will resist movement and shed water better. Consider a thicker base and proper compaction for long-term durability in local conditions.

A quick rule: cubic yards = area (sq ft) x depth (ft) / 27; for example a 20x10 ft area at 3 inches (0.25 ft) is about 1.85 cubic yards. Material weight varies, so use our calculator or ask us to convert cubic yards to tons for gravel, sand, dirt, stone. Order 5-10% extra for compaction, settling, and waste.

For small landscaping tasks or garden beds many homeowners can handle material delivery and installation themselves. For large driveways, major grading, drainage work, or when specialized equipment is needed, hiring a contractor is often safer and more efficient. Consider your experience, equipment access, and permit requirements when deciding.

Clear the drop area of vehicles, lawn furniture, and low-hanging branches and mark the preferred dump spot with flags or stakes. Make sure trucks can access the site and note any narrow gates or soft ground. You can request tailgate spreading at checkout but drivers will only spread if it can be done safely and without damage.
